imagine软件在游戏设计中的应用有哪些?

在游戏设计领域,imagine软件作为一种功能强大的设计工具,已经得到了广泛的应用。它不仅可以帮助设计师们更高效地完成游戏设计工作,还能提升游戏的整体质量和用户体验。以下是imagine软件在游戏设计中的应用的几个方面:

一、场景设计

  1. 视觉效果制作:imagine软件提供了丰富的3D建模、贴图、灯光等工具,可以帮助设计师快速制作出高质量的场景模型。通过调整材质、纹理、光照等参数,设计师可以创造出丰富多彩的游戏世界。

  2. 场景布局:imagine软件支持多种场景布局方式,如网格、曲线、对称等。设计师可以根据游戏需求,快速调整场景布局,确保游戏画面美观、流畅。

  3. 场景交互:利用imagine软件,设计师可以设置场景中的交互元素,如按钮、开关、机关等。通过编写脚本,实现场景与玩家之间的互动,提升游戏趣味性。

二、角色设计

  1. 角色建模:imagine软件提供了丰富的角色建模工具,支持多边形、NURBS等多种建模方式。设计师可以轻松创建各种角色模型,满足不同游戏的需求。

  2. 角色动画:imagine软件内置了动画制作功能,支持骨骼动画、蒙皮动画等多种动画类型。设计师可以制作出流畅、自然的角色动画,增强游戏表现力。

  3. 角色表情:通过imagine软件,设计师可以制作出丰富的角色表情,如喜怒哀乐、惊讶、疑惑等。这些表情可以帮助角色更好地传达情感,增强玩家代入感。

三、道具设计

  1. 道具建模:imagine软件提供了丰富的道具建模工具,支持各种材质、纹理、光照效果。设计师可以快速制作出各种道具模型,丰富游戏内容。

  2. 道具交互:利用imagine软件,设计师可以设置道具的交互效果,如触发事件、改变游戏状态等。通过编写脚本,实现道具与玩家之间的互动,提升游戏趣味性。

  3. 道具升级:在imagine软件中,设计师可以设计道具的升级系统,如通过收集材料、完成任务等方式提升道具属性。这有助于增加游戏的挑战性和玩家参与度。

四、游戏逻辑设计

  1. 脚本编写:imagine软件支持多种脚本语言,如Python、Lua等。设计师可以利用这些脚本语言编写游戏逻辑,实现游戏中的各种功能,如角色成长、任务系统、战斗系统等。

  2. 事件触发:通过imagine软件,设计师可以设置游戏中的事件触发条件,如时间、玩家操作等。当满足条件时,游戏会自动执行相应的逻辑,实现丰富的游戏情节。

  3. 数据管理:imagine软件支持数据管理功能,如角色属性、道具属性、任务数据等。设计师可以方便地管理游戏数据,确保游戏内容的丰富性和可扩展性。

五、游戏测试与优化

  1. 游戏测试:利用imagine软件,设计师可以快速搭建游戏测试环境,对游戏进行测试。通过测试,发现并修复游戏中的bug,提升游戏质量。

  2. 性能优化:imagine软件提供了性能分析工具,可以帮助设计师分析游戏性能,找出瓶颈。通过优化代码、调整资源等手段,提升游戏运行效率。

  3. 用户体验优化:利用imagine软件,设计师可以模拟玩家操作,观察游戏界面、交互效果等。通过优化设计,提升玩家在游戏中的体验。

总之,imagine软件在游戏设计中的应用非常广泛,从场景设计、角色设计、道具设计到游戏逻辑设计、测试与优化,都能发挥重要作用。掌握imagine软件,有助于设计师提升游戏设计水平,打造出更加优秀、富有创意的游戏作品。

猜你喜欢:在线聊天室